Swami Vivekananda chose the orthodox Swami Ramakrishnananda to establish Sri Ramakrishna?s teachings in southern India, because he felt that he was 'unsurpassed in his worship and meditation on God'. This book contains his life and work, reminiscences about him, and a selection of his sayings.
